The real NFL Draft has passed, but April Badness is still here for your enjoyment. We began with 32 first-round busts, and now only two remain. There have been a few surprises, but our top overall seed and champion of the Jim Irsay Region, Ryan Leaf, has taken down every fellow bust in his path. His Final Four opponent -- Tony Mandarich, the last man standing in the Mike Brown Region. On the other side of the bracket, another pair of infamous busts. Representing the Ray Perkins bracket was Lawrence Phillips going against the champion of the Matt Millen Region, Tim Couch.

Who are the lucky two men left? Without further ado, let's get to the results!!

Finals
#1 Leaf vs. #1 Phillips
And then there were two...A repeat offender of violent crimes takes on a repeat offender for being an ****. Well perhaps Phillips falls into both categories, but nonetheless, he will go toe-to-toe with Leaf to decide once and for all who the worst first-round pick of all time is.

Ryan Leaf, QB
School: Washington State
Draft class: Selected second overall in 1998 by San Diego
Drafted after: Peyton Manning
Drafted before: Charles Woodson, Curtis Enis, Fred Taylor, Randy Moss
Key personality trait: Pissing people off
Notable achievement: Married a Chargers cheerleader, although that failed too.

Lawrence Phillips, RB
School: Nebraska
Draft class: Selected sixth overall in 1996 by the St. Louis Rams
Drafted after: Keyshawn Johnson, Simeon Rice, Jonathan Ogden
Drafted before: Eddie George, Marvin Harrison, Ray Lewis
Key personality trait: Able to make **** Vermeil cry
Notable achievement: Scored three TDs in California Penal League championship game
